What is the purpose of this form?
The purpose of this form is to formally request a court to quash an arrest warrant issued under specific circumstances. It allows the defendant to present relevant information and request a hearing in a timely manner. This form plays a crucial role in ensuring that defendants can contest legal actions against them appropriately.
